Russian Qt Forum
Сентябрь 30, 2024, 16:32 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
 
  Начало   Форум  WIKI (Вики)FAQ Помощь Поиск Войти Регистрация  

Страниц: [1]   Вниз
  Печать  
Автор Тема: Что почитать для начала разработки приложения для БД?  (Прочитано 4469 раз)
KBAC
Гость
« : Декабрь 05, 2011, 17:06 »

 Непонимающий
Записан
Rem Norton
Гость
« Ответ #1 : Декабрь 05, 2011, 17:22 »

Смотря что следует понимать, под "приложеним для БД". Что конкретно хочется (или нужно) писать?
Записан
BRE
Гость
« Ответ #2 : Декабрь 05, 2011, 17:24 »

http://citforum.ru/database/dbguide/index.shtml
Записан
KBAC
Гость
« Ответ #3 : Декабрь 05, 2011, 17:37 »

Надо написать приложение для отображения и изменения содержимого БД.  BRE, спс. Но и что-то более конкретное нужно по классам qt sql. Может лучше ничего и нет чем документация, но хотелось бы что-то с бОльшим количеством примеров.

Я не понимаю, где писать код для подсоединения БД в частности. В конструкторе основной формы ?
« Последнее редактирование: Декабрь 05, 2011, 17:47 от KBAC » Записан
Rem Norton
Гость
« Ответ #4 : Декабрь 05, 2011, 18:19 »

Надо написать приложение для отображения и изменения содержимого БД.  BRE, спс. Но и что-то более конкретное нужно по классам qt sql. Может лучше ничего и нет чем документация, но хотелось бы что-то с бОльшим количеством примеров.

Я не понимаю, где писать код для подсоединения БД в частности. В конструкторе основной формы ?
Если дело в этом, то можно почитать форум.  Смеющийся

А вообще соединение с базой открывается там, где его начинают использовать. Если есть необходимость обращения к базе в конструкторе формы, то значит там и соединяйся. Можно открывать соединение в main.cpp. В общем тут все зависит от фантазии разработчика.

Рекомендую изучить примеры, попробовать повторить их "на свой лад", а потом уже "с шашкою на танк".

Желаю успехов!
Записан
thechicho
Гость
« Ответ #5 : Декабрь 05, 2011, 18:21 »

http://doc.qt.nokia.com/latest/examples-sql.html
Записан
Пантер
Administrator
Джедай : наставник для всех
*****
Offline Offline

Сообщений: 5876


Жаждущий знаний


Просмотр профиля WWW
« Ответ #6 : Декабрь 05, 2011, 18:38 »

Нужно для начала выучить SQL. А у Qt есть 3 основных класса QSqlDatabase, QSqlQuery и QSqlError.
Записан

1. Qt - Qt Development Frameworks; QT - QuickTime
2. Не используйте в исходниках символы кириллицы!!!
3. Пользуйтесь тегом code при оформлении сообщений.
Страниц: [1]   Вверх
  Печать  
 
Перейти в:  


Страница сгенерирована за 0.129 секунд. Запросов: 22.